Exploring the Regions of France with Michelin Maps of France

One of the best things about Michelin Maps of France is that it allows you to explore the country's different regions in detail. Each region has its unique charm and attractions, and this guide provides a wealth of information on each one. For example, I recently used Michelin Maps of France to plan a trip to the Loire Valley. This region is known for its stunning chateaux, vineyards, and picturesque countryside. The guide provided detailed information on each chateau, including its history and architectural style, as well as recommended routes for scenic drives and cycling tours.

Discovering Local Culture with Michelin Maps of France

France is a country with a rich and diverse culture, and Michelin Maps of France offers insight into its local customs and traditions. The guide provides information on local events and festivals, as well as recommended restaurants and hotels that offer an authentic French experience. During my trip to the Provence region, I used Michelin Maps of France to discover the local markets and food festivals. I also visited some of the region's most beautiful villages, such as Gordes and Roussillon, which are renowned for their unique architecture and stunning landscapes.
